WHY GLD ETF IS MOVING TODAY
Today's 3.01% surge in GLD is a testament to the complex dance of market forces. As fear and uncertainty cloud the broader markets, investors are flocking to gold. The strengthening US dollar might usually discourage gold buyers, but the falling bond yields—reflected in the rising iShares 20+ Year Treasury Bond ETF (TLT)—suggest an environment ripe for assets like gold. These conditions reduce the opportunity cost of holding gold, even as it becomes more expensive for foreign buyers due to the currency fluctuations.
GLD tracks the price of physical gold, offering investors exposure to the precious metal without the need for physical storage.
